Senjan Jansen is a composer, sound designer and music producer working across disciplines and internationally in the performing arts, visual arts, fashion and film industries. His collaboration with American choreographer Meg Stuart on his final short film 'Distance' for his studies in film directing at the RITCS School of Arts in Brussels marked the beginning of his specialization in sound direction. Further collaborations followed, such as with renowned directors Jan Lauwers/Needcompany and Wim Vandekeybus. Together with Belgian writer and director Bart Meuleman and Dutch director and actress Abke Haring, he created 'Maison Fragile' in 2004, which led to a long-lasting collaboration. Over the years he has worked with performing artist:s such as FC Bergman ('JR', 'Terminator Trilogy', 'The Sheep Song'), Salva Sanchis ('Radical Light'), Ontroerend Goed ('TM') and for the Munich Kammerspiele with Michiel van de Velde for 'Joy 2022'. In addition, Jansen frequently works with auteur filmmakers and has composed for directors such as Fien Troch, Tim Mielants, Laure Prouvost, Koen Mortier and Nicolas Provost, among others. Together with Joris Vermeiren, Jansen also produces his own music under the label discodesafinado. The minimal techno, which includes experimental electronic music almost symbiotically, has been used for high-fashion labels such as Diesel, Y-Project, Glenn Martens, Akris and Christian Wijnants, among others.
